0 Пользователей и 1 Гость просматривают эту тему.
  • 2 Ответов
  • 1612 Просмотров
*

myborisogleb

  • Новичок
  • 9
  • 1 / 0
Уважаемые разработчики! Помогите вывести например через модуль mod_flexi_customcode общее число комментариев  и общее число комментаторов на сайте (даже тех, кто не зарегистирован, но пишет комментарии под одним и тем же гостевым ником). Нужны только цифры.

+п.с. если есть возможность вывода числа комментариев за период (например за последний месяц) - буду оччч рад!
« Последнее редактирование: 19.10.2012, 12:11:05 от smart »
создать сообщество блоггеров из обычных людей: мойборисоглеб.рф + jcomments
*

smart

  • Администратор
  • 6485
  • 1315 / 15
  • Хочешь сделать хорошо — сделай!
Я объединил 2 темы в одну, ибо по смыслу они очень близки. Судя по всему статистика вещь полезная для сайта, и поэтому я в ближайшее время сделаю отдельный модуль для отображения такой информации. А пока привожу здесь готовые куски кода для отображения статистической информации:

Общее количество комментаторов:
Код: php
<?php
$db = JFactory::getDBO();
$db->setQuery('SELECT COUNT(DISTINCT userid, username) FROM #__jcomments;');
echo $db->loadResult();

Общее количество опубликованных комментариев на сайте:
Код: php
<?php
$db = JFactory::getDBO();
$db->setQuery('SELECT COUNT(*) FROM `#__jcomments` WHERE `published` = 1;');
echo $db->loadResult();

Общее количество опубликованных комментариев на сайте за последний месяц:
Код: php
<?php
$db = JFactory::getDBO();
$date = JFactory::getDate();
$dateFrom = JFactory::getDate(strtotime('-1 month', $date->toUnix()));
$dateTo = $date;
$db->setQuery('SELECT COUNT(*) FROM `#__jcomments` WHERE `published` = 1 AND `date` BETWEEN ' . $db->Quote($dateFrom->toMySQL()). ' AND ' . $db->Quote($dateTo->toMySQL()));
echo $db->loadResult();
« Последнее редактирование: 22.10.2012, 12:03:26 от smart »
*

myborisogleb

  • Новичок
  • 9
  • 1 / 0
Вот огроменное спасибище!
Как попробую - отпишусь обязательно.
Спасибо за быстрый и дельный ответ
создать сообщество блоггеров из обычных людей: мойборисоглеб.рф + jcomments
Чтобы оставить сообщение,
Вам необходимо Войти или Зарегистрироваться
 

Сделать отказ для некоторых комментариев

Автор relat

Ответов: 11
Просмотров: 405
Последний ответ 20.05.2018, 10:45:43
от Beer
Вывод всех комментариев на отдельной странице

Автор Rom008

Ответов: 3
Просмотров: 121
Последний ответ 11.05.2018, 04:41:19
от Cedars
Строка обновить список комментариев налезает на комментарии в jcomments

Автор 964758

Ответов: 9
Просмотров: 627
Последний ответ 21.10.2017, 08:14:47
от ABTOP
Не отображается jComments на мультиязычном сайте

Автор Netman_avs

Ответов: 16
Просмотров: 3285
Последний ответ 10.09.2017, 23:34:58
от Sorbon
Один список комментариев для разных языков?

Автор yara

Ответов: 56
Просмотров: 18654
Последний ответ 22.07.2017, 17:05:12
от endspiel